1*91f16700Schasinglulu /* 2*91f16700Schasinglulu * Copyright (c) 2019, ARM Limited. All rights reserved. 3*91f16700Schasinglulu * 4*91f16700Schasinglulu * SPDX-License-Identifier: BSD-3-Clause 5*91f16700Schasinglulu */ 6*91f16700Schasinglulu 7*91f16700Schasinglulu #include <drivers/arm/scu.h> 8*91f16700Schasinglulu #include <plat/arm/common/plat_arm.h> 9*91f16700Schasinglulu 10*91f16700Schasinglulu 11*91f16700Schasinglulu void plat_arm_sp_min_early_platform_setup(u_register_t arg0, u_register_t arg1, 12*91f16700Schasinglulu u_register_t arg2, u_register_t arg3) 13*91f16700Schasinglulu { 14*91f16700Schasinglulu arm_sp_min_early_platform_setup((void *)arg0, arg1, arg2, (void *)arg3); 15*91f16700Schasinglulu 16*91f16700Schasinglulu /* enable snoop control unit */ 17*91f16700Schasinglulu enable_snoop_ctrl_unit(A5DS_SCU_BASE); 18*91f16700Schasinglulu } 19*91f16700Schasinglulu 20*91f16700Schasinglulu /* 21*91f16700Schasinglulu * A5DS will only have one always-on power domain and there 22*91f16700Schasinglulu * is no power control present. 23*91f16700Schasinglulu */ 24*91f16700Schasinglulu void plat_arm_pwrc_setup(void) 25*91f16700Schasinglulu { 26*91f16700Schasinglulu } 27*91f16700Schasinglulu 28